Cristina Serrano is a scholar working on Pathology and Forensic Medicine,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Cristina Serrano has authored 40 papers receiving a total of 567 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ine, 8 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 8 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Cristina Serrano's work include CNS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(5 papers), Viral-associated cancers and disorders (4 papers) and Emotional Intelligence and Performance (4 papers). Cristina Serrano is often cited by papers focused on CNS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(5 papers), Viral-associated cancers and disorders (4 papers) and Emotional Intelligence and Performance (4 papers). Cristina Serrano collaborates with scholars based in Spain, United States and Portugal. Cristina Serrano's co-authors include Yolanda Andreu, Sergio Murgui, David Herrera, Lorenzo de Arriba, Mariano Sanz, Bettina Alonso, Susana Castañón, Dolores Subirá, María-José Almagro and Paula Martínez and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Blood and Journal of Allergy and Clinical Immunology.
